So, honestly, I felt a little outside our tax bracket. We saved all year to afford our stay and to swim with the manatees... but I got the impression the guests here could afford it on a whim. This wasn't a bad thing... I just want to set that expectation. We barely got to see the manatees... but again, that is nobody's fault... we came at the wrong time of year. During the summer, there may be a total of 40 manatees in the entire canal. I would suggest you book your swim during the cooler months... our captain said there are hundreds that come in for the warm shallows. The beds were sooooo comfortable and had the best pillows. We stayed at three different resorts this vacation, and these beds couldn't be beat. The bathroom was a basic bathroom... nothing special, but nothing against it either. I think some people were put off by the towel policy that read something along the lines of, "To conserve water, we wash towels every three days unless requested otherwise." I believe this is why some people gave bad reviews for cleanliness... but you have the option to have them washed every day if you want. The wifi was decent, which was good because we had NO cell service until we were back in the main city down the road. The only BAD thing I can say was that their tv channel selection was horrible. I mean, the live feed from the International Space Station on the NASA channel from the recent launch was cool... but didn't interest a 4 year old. The only cartoon channel we could find was Disney. But she was content with it, so no points marked down there. We didn't swim in the pool... but it looked clean and was a decent size. Plenty of places to lay down and relax. There was a little tiki bar... didn't use that either, but everyone sitting there seemed to be enjoying themselves. The hot tub appeared clean, too. We decided to sleep in, so we missed breakfast at the restaurant. We had a free meal voucher for breakfast that came with our manatees trip... but ehhh... sleep was more important. I imagine without that voucher, the food was probably pretttty costly. It looked quite fancy. My favorite thing about our stay is foolish... but it made me giggle, so I took a photo and posted it below. I hope you get a laugh, too. Oh, and we got this really cool doll included with our manatees swim!

My wife and I have stayed at the Plantation Inn many times over the past 20 years though always in March or April. We have used it as a one night stay on our way to other vacation destinations, we have spent two nights usually doing a manatee or golf package, and we have stayed for one week.

I will say all of our experiences have been pleasurable for different reasons. I believe there have been different owners or management teams through the years and sometimes there have been minor irritants such as old hallway carpet, a crusty staff person running the main desk, or the locals that were allowed to enter and loudly occupy the pool. The good though has made these irritants basically non-issues.

As you can see from the photo’s on their website, this is a very beautiful hotel! The rooms are somewhat basic but have always been clean and the beds very comfortable. The restaurant offers very tasty food though we have only experienced breakfast there as we have headed out and sampled the many different restaurants in the area for our other meals. The breakfast buffet has always been really good with the variety and quality of their food.

The Inn is situated on canals overlooking the bay and the grounds are quite extensive. At the right time of the year one can often peer down into the water and see the manatees that can be so abundant in this area. The pool is beautiful and draws quite a few people on the warmer sunny days while the hot tub is occupied regardless of the weather. A bonus is the cool tiki bar located poolside!

We have participated in Manatee snorkel tours twice. The first one happened on a day when the temperatures were in the 30’s. The water was unusually clear and due to the cold the manatees were everywhere. It was an unbelievable experience. Being a fisherman I wandered off and found myself in the midst of a school of hundreds or more mullet and swam next to 6 ft Tarpon and observed black and white stripped Sheepshead, Snappers and more. Our second trip was as disappointing as our first was brilliant. It was late in the season so most of the manatee had moved out to the ocean and the water was cloudy making finding them nearly impossible. Our guide took as up some canals where we did find a couple Manatee and a majority of the snorkelers got in the shallower water and went after the Manatee (which is a no no) and the guide did nothing to discourage this.

We have golfed here several times and have enjoyed that. The course is relatively pretty and has not been crowded if we golf in the afternoon.

I would suggest checking out their packages as they offer some good deals!
